导言:
“tpwallettoken error”通常出现在区块链钱包或支付 SDK 与链、合约或签名模块交互时。表面看是一个错误提示,但底层可能牵涉链路、签名、授权、合约兼容性和节点一致性等多重因素。本文将全面解释该错误可能的成因,并在此基础上深入探讨密钥备份、高科技发展趋势、专业评估、创新支付应用、拜占庭容错与数据冗余的关系与实践建议。
一、tpwallettoken 错误的主要成因与排查
1. 签名/认证失败:私钥不匹配、链 ID 错误、签名算法不兼容(如 ECDSA vs 算法差异)或 SDK 版本变动导致格式差异。
2. 会话/令牌失效:本地或服务端 token 过期、nonce 重放或同步问题。
3. 合约不兼容:ABI、方法签名或代币标准(ERC20/721/1155)不匹配,导致调用被回滚。
4. RPC/节点问题:节点不同步、链分叉、链上重组或节点返回错误导致请求失败。
5. 权限与额度:代币未授权、allowance 不足、gas 估算失败或交易被拒绝。
6. 本地存储与密钥管理:keystore 损坏、助记词错误或硬件钱包通讯失败。
排查步骤:核对链ID与合约地址;查看交易回滚原因(revert reason);确认签名格式与 SDK 版本;检查 allowance/gas;换节点或重试;在安全环境验证私钥/助记词一致性。
二、密钥备份与恢复策略
1. 助记词与 keystore:安全离线保存助记词,使用加密 keystore 并设置强口令。
2. 硬件钱包与多重签名:优先采用硬件安全模块(HSM)或硬件钱包;对高价值账户使用多签(multisig)分散风险。
3. 门限方案(Shamir / MPC):采用 Shamir Secret Sharing 或多方计算(MPC)将私钥分片分散存储,既保证恢复也避免单点泄露。
4. 冗余与异地存储:在不同物理位置和介质(纸质、金属刻录、离线闪存)保存备份,防止单点灾难。
三、高科技发展趋势与对策
1. 多方计算(MPC)与阈值签名将成为主流,取代单一私钥模型,既提高安全又便于企业化管理。
2. 可验证计算与零知识证明(ZK):在隐私支付与合规审计间取得平衡。
3. 安全硬件演进:TEE、专用安全芯片与量子抗性算法的部署;关注后量子加密过渡。
4. 去中心化身份(DID)与可组合支付原语,推动跨链与可编程支付场景。
四、专业评估与治理
1. 风险评估:采用威胁建模(T-MODEL)、红队演练与代码审计相结合,覆盖密钥生命周期、接口与链上逻辑。
2. 合规与审计:对接 KYC/AML 与合规日志保存,采用不可篡改的审计链或多方签名审计。
3. SLA 与监控:对支付关键路径设定 SLO,部署链上/链下监控与告警,快速定位 tpwallettoken 类错误。
五、创新支付应用场景
1. 微支付与实时结算:基于支付通道、Rollup 与 Layer2 提供低费率高频支付。
2. 设备级支付(IoT):设备端使用轻量签名与阈值授权实现自动订阅与微账务结算。
3. 资产通证化与可组合金融:支付与通证化结合,智能合约支持条件支付与原子交换。
4. 跨链支付与桥接:安全桥与跨链清算机制是实现多链支付的关键,但需注意拜占庭攻击面。
六、拜占庭容错(BFT)与数据冗余的作用
1. BFT 在共识层保证一致性与最终性,降低恶意节点影响。对于支付系统,采用 BFT 或 BFT 风格共识(如 Tendermint)能提升确认速度与安全边界。
2. 数据冗余通过多副本、分片与纠删码(erasure coding)保证可用性与持久性。结合 BFT,可在节点失效或被攻陷时仍维持服务。
3. 设计权衡:一致性、可用性与分区容忍(CAP)需根据业务关键度调整,支付系统通常更偏向于最终性与一致性。
七、综合建议与实践清单
1. 复现并记录错误上下文(节点、链ID、nonce、回滚原因、SDK 版本)。
2. 优先检查签名链路与合约兼容性;在测试网重现并回退 SDK 做 A/B 比较。
3. 建立密钥策略:硬件钱包 + 多签 + MPC 分层管理,定期演练恢复流程。
4. 采用 BFT 共识或 BFT 辅助服务保证一致性;数据采用多副本与纠删码冗余。

5. 定期进行第三方安全评估、渗透测试与代码审计,并对运维人员进行安全培训。
结语:

tpwallettoken error 往往是表象,解决需要从签名、链路、合约与密钥管理多维度排查。结合现代密钥备份方法、MPC、BFT 架构与数据冗余策略,可以显著降低故障率并提升支付系统的弹性与安全性。对于希望在创新支付领域规模化的机构,建议尽早将门限签名、硬件安全与专业评估纳入产品与合规流程。
评论
Neo小白
讲得很全面,尤其是把 MPC 和多签结合的建议很实用。
CryptoLark
关于排查步骤的清单简洁明了,已保存备用。
张安
能否分享更多关于后量子迁移的实际案例?很感兴趣。
SoraDream
对 BFT 与数据冗余的权衡描述得很好,适合做架构讨论时引用。